  Hello,
  I have a Nvidia GeForce 8600M GS, with proprietary drivers, and I am using Ubuntu Natty.

  Since I updated to Natty (it was the Beta 2 version), plymouth only
  shows a purple screen, without logo and without dots. It's simply
  purple.

  Note that, before updating, I had already solved the issue which made
  plymouth show the Ubuntu logo textual theme instead of the graphic one
  with proprietary drivers on Nvidia cards, so I don't think it's
  related (unless some of the files I modified were reset during the
  update, I don't know). This time, however, I don't even get the
  "default" text theme.
